This appears to be HP getting out some buzz on the new line that was announced a few weeks ago.

The following models have been announced. (click the model name for a link to our newly created forums for each)

  • HP iPAQ 110: Standard PDA with a sleek new form factor
  • HP iPAQ 210: Enterprise PDA with a 4? screen perfect for running diagnostic applications for field technicians, etc
  • HP iPAQ 310: An update to last year’s navigation device, features 3-D mapping for major US cities
  • HP iPAQ 610: New 12-key smart phone device with scroll wheel
  • HP iPAQ 910: New QWERTY smart phone device
